    P100 does not indicate skill level, time played does not indicate skill level.

    I think it's funny how some killers get intimidated by a P100 in the lobby and dodge, or watching Twitch streamers obsessively viewing everyone's profile to check how many hours they have played. Being told I'm bad solely because I'm P3 with Leon or have 300 hours, when I have every other survivor and killer P3 or higher, and I have 1.5k hours across multiple platforms,BUT NOT that it matters, it's just funny.

    We've all played with or against P100 players with thousands of hours that were mediocre at best, like.. you've grinded that much and played that much just to be that mediocre, but somehow you think you're good because you simply dumped all your time into DBD. There's a saying about how it takes 10k hours to achieve mastery in any skill. While I believe in this saying, it only applies to those that actively practiced that skill in a proper manner for 10k hours. In other words, your 3k hours of playing DBD does not indicate you actively improved your skill level for 3k hours consecutively.
